Somalia Floods: Deputy Prime Minister Convenes Business Leaders

Mogadishu, SOMALIA — As the Somalia floods wreak havoc across the nation, the Deputy Prime Minister of the Federal Government of Somalia, Mr. Salah Ahmed Jama, proactively summoned prominent members of the Somali business community to an urgent conference. They gathered to formulate a response to the humanitarian crisis triggered by relentless autumnal rains that have led to devastating floods across the nation.

Somalia Floods: Tallying the Toll

Mr. Salah Ahmed Jama presided over the meeting where he shared alarming statistics: the floods in Somalia have claimed 25 lives and directly affected over 717,000 individuals. He emphasized the looming threat of more rainfall and further floods, which have already left many communities cut off from aid and resources. Consequently, he urged that the situation required immediate attention and swift action.

Mobilizing Resources and Resolve

Moreover, recognizing the scale of the disaster caused by the floods in Somalia, the Deputy Prime Minister implored the business leaders to rally their support and resources to aid those in dire need. The business leaders, responding to the call, pledged their commitment and resources to the relief efforts, showcasing the enduring spirit of solidarity that sustains the nation in such challenging times.

Strategic Discussions for Sustained Relief Efforts

Following these initial deliberations, the meeting focused on strategic planning. Importantly, the dialogue centered on the regions hardest hit by the floods—Gedo, Lower Jubba, Middle Jubba, Bay, Bakool, Hiran, Mudug, and Galgadud. There, the participants outlined strategies for an efficient relief operation that could quickly mobilize necessary resources and provide immediate support to the besieged communities.

Uniting a Nation in the Face of the Floods in Somalia

In addition, the Deputy Prime Minister and the business leaders acknowledged the severity of the crisis, committing to concerted efforts to support the flood-affected regions. This united front between the government and the business sector exemplified a shared dedication to not only bring immediate relief but also to sustain efforts for long-term recovery.

Ongoing Commitment to Rebuild and Restore

Finally, as the meeting concluded, the government and the business community, alongside other stakeholders, affirmed their readiness to take decisive and collaborative action. They recognized that their work extends beyond the current crisis caused by the Somalia floods, committing to strategies that will help prevent such disasters in the future and ensure the nation’s resilience against the challenges that lie ahead. This joint approach signifies a determined effort to rebuild and fortify the affected areas, instilling hope in the hearts of the Somali people.
